Klippel Announces New dB Lab 210 and QC 6.6 Audio Analyzer Software Updates
The Klippel Analyzer System has received another software update with new features for both R&D and QC applications. The updates are free of charge for any users of dB-Lab major version 210 or QC 6, respectively and provide new relevant tools for output-based testing of contemporary DSP-enhanced speakers, headphones and other audio systems according to the IEC 60268-21 standard.
New 19-Inch Rackmount Surface Mount Back Boxes from Redco Audio
Redco Audio, the Connecticut specialist in audio and video cables, connectors, panels and accessories, continues to expand its wide variety of professional solutions, now introducing new 19-inch-long Back Boxes in 1U, 2U, and 3U sizes. Designed to work with any rackmountable panels, these new boxes are the perfect solution for easy surface mounting. The boxes 4" depth allows for plenty of room behind the panel, including for cable clearance.

Analog Devices Confirms Maxim Integrated Acquisition
Analog Devices (ADI) and Maxim Integrated Products announced that they have entered into a definitive agreement under which ADI will acquire Maxim in an all stock transaction that values the combined enterprise at over $68 billion. The combination of the two North-American semiconductor companies was announced to increase scale and diversification of the combined business, enhancing domain expertise and breadth of engineering capabilities to develop more complete solutions. The transaction is expected to close in the summer of 2021.

Studio Six Digital Introduces Updated Surround Signal Generator with Dolby Atmos for Apple TV
Studio Six Digital has released an updated version of its Surround Sound Signal Generator for Apple TV. This app is available from the Apple TV App Store and is an essential tool for integrators. To install it, users just need to navigate to the App Store on an Apple TV, and search for “Surround Generator”. When installed, the app offers a variety of test signals that can be used with Studio Six Digital's AudioTools app to help check speaker polarity, delay, and EQ to optimize the surround audio experience.
Fraunhofer IIS Licenses LC3 Audio Codec Software to Microsoft
The Fraunhofer Institute for Integrated Circuits IIS announced the licensing of its LC3 software implementation to Microsoft Corp. LC3 (Low Complexity Communication Codec) is the audio codec adopted for Bluetooth LE Audio, a new audio architecture designed to boost the performance of Bluetooth Audio – for voice calls as well as for media playback including music. Following the news that Microsoft had licensed the xHE-AAC codec and MPEG-D DRC software implementation from Fraunhofer IIS, the addition of LC3 is a logic step.

GRAS Announces The World's Thinnest Condenser Microphones
GRAS Sound & Vibration is adding to its existing family of measurement microphones for boundary layer measurements and specifically wind tunnel testing – the new Ultra-Thin Precision (UTP) microphones. The UTP microphones - based on a patented technology - combine the high precision and reliability of GRAS measurement microphones with the need for extremely low-profiled (1 mm) microphones with minimum turbulence influence.
